Decision CRTC 96-775-1
Image Wireless Communications Inc.
Aberdeen, Allan Hills, Gronlid, Lloydminster, Marquis, North Battleford, Prince Albert, Regina, Stranraer, Swift Current, Warmley, Wynyard and Yorkton, Saskatchewan - 952485100
Correction
In Decision CRTC 96-775, the Commission approved the application by Image Wireless Communications Inc. for licences to carry on radiocommunication distribution undertakings to serve the various communities in Saskatchewan noted above.
In the appendix to that decision, condition of licence 2, which sets out the programming services authorized for distribution by the undertakings, contained an error in the first sentence, in that the word "licensed" was omitted.
The Commission hereby corrects Decision CRTC 96-775 dated 4 December 1996 by replacing condition of licence 2 with the following:
2. The licensee is authorized to distribute any licensed specialty, pay television and radio services, except a radio service of the type discussed in paragraph 16(3)(d) of the Cable Television Regulations, 1986, as well as any of the programming services contained in the list of "Part II Eligible Satellite Services" attached to Public Notice CRTC 1996-137 dated 16 October 1996 and amended from time to time, and in accordance with the distribution and linkage requirements as set out in condition of licence 5. In addition, the licensee is authorized to distribute the following programming services:
 Cable Public Affairs Inc. (CPAC), English- and French-language/
La Chaîne d'affaires publiques par câble Inc. (CPAC), services de langues française et
anglaise
 Saskatchewan Legislature Proceedings/
  Débats de l'assemblée législative de la Saskatchewan
 Electronic Program Guide/Guide-horaire électronique
 Sega Canada Inc.
This decision is to be appended to each of the licences issued in respect of Decision CRTC 96-775.
